Does anyone know of a way to get the product key that was used to activate Windows 8?

Bonus points for an updated algorithm to extract the product key from the registry key.

While I realize this question has been asked for other versions of Windows, it looks like like many of the older activation key detection tools do not work with Windows 8. Most seem to return strings of the right form (e.g. 5 x 5 characters) but they do not match the actual product key.

UPDATE : This question was originally asked when Windows 8 was first released. It seems most of the tools now handle Win8 properly . . .

The free OEM Product Key Tool from NeoSmart Technologies is probably the most straight-forward way of doing this. Just run the standalone exe and it'll come up in the main dialog like this:

NeoSmart product key tool

Unlike other tools, it pulls the key from the ACPI tables, meaning it'll get the embedded Windows 8 product key even if Windows has been formatted.

Disclosure: I'm the author of this tool
